The 2018–19 Myanmar Women's League (also known as the KBZ Bank Myanmar Women's League for sponsorship reasons) was the 3rd season of the Myanmar Women's League, the top Myanmar professional league for women's association football clubs, since its establishment in 2016. A tota of 8 teams competed in the league, with the season beginning on 3 December 2018.[1]

Myawady were the defending champions, having won the Myanmar Women's League title the previous season.

League table

Below is the league table for 2018–19 season.

Pos Team Pld W D L GF GA GD Pts Qualification
1 ISPE 14 12 1 1 90 7 +83 37 Qualification for 2022 AFC Women's Club Championship group stage
2 Myawady 14 11 2 1 68 8 +60 35
3 Thitsar Arman 14 10 2 2 54 6 +48 32
4 YREO 14 7 1 6 34 31 +3 22
5 Sport & Education 14 5 2 7 22 41 −19 17
6 Zwekapin United 14 5 0 9 33 33 0 15
7 Gandamar 14 2 0 12 9 77 −68 6
8 University 14 0 0 14 8 115 −107 0
